    The principle of the phenomenon that the infrared imaging system may defocus with the change of temperature is analyzed, and a linear infrared athermalization detection system is proposed. The characteristics of linear infrared imaging are analyzed. To solve the problem that the traditional methods of SMD, TenenGrad, Laplacian are prone to be disturbed by the stripe noise of the linear infrared system and considering the shape of the target plate, a method of definition evaluation based on the improved Sobel operator in seven directions is proposed. The experimental results show that this method can effectively overcome the interference of the stripe random noise of the linear infrared imaging system on the definition evaluation factor. Comparing with that of the traditional algorithms, the response curve of the proposed algorithm has obvious variation tendency and small fluctuation. It can better meet the monotonic and unbiased requirements of autofocusing.
